Jack McGregor, a former state senator and the original founder of the Pittsburgh Penguins, died at the age of 91 on Tuesday. The organization announced the news in a post on social media on Thursday. "The team extends our deepest condolences to his family, friends, and teammates during this difficult time," a post on X said.

Though the Penguins are flawed, they don’t necessarily have a glaring weakness. Their forwards are pretty good. The left side of their blue line has played much better than expected. So, too, has Erik Karlsson. Kris Letang is showing signs of life in recent games. The goaltending isn’t great, but reinforcements are already in the organization.
